NettetHuman insulin – This is synthetic and made in a laboratory to be like insulin made in the body. Analogue insulin –This is also synthetic and made in the laboratory but scientists have managed to alter the position of some of the beads to create genetically engineered insulin known as analogues. Nettet17. feb. 2024 · Carbohydrates raise insulin the most; Protein raises insulin about half as much as carbohydrates (46%) over the first two hours; The fibre in food reduces the … Nettet26. jun. 2024 · There are six main types of insulin available. Rapid-acting: These include Apidra, Humalog, and Novolog. They have an onset of less than 15 minutes, peak in 30 to 90 minutes, and duration of two to four hours. Regular (short-acting): These include Humulin R and Novolin R. They have an onset of a half an hour, a peak of two to three …

Nettet20. feb. 2024 · Insulin Regimens. The goal of subcutaneous insulin therapy is to mimic both the normal prandial insulin secretion and the basal between-meal insulin levels as close as possible. To accomplish this goal most current regimens use at least two different insulin analogs: Long-acting or Intermediate acting insulins are used to provide basal …
